What To Check Before The Truck Arrives
Preparation before pickup day pays off quickly. A handful of basic checks can turn a frustrating removal into a fast, predictable visit.
For a refrigerator, the basics are simple but important. Empty the contents, unplug it in advance, and make sure any ice has time to thaw so the move does not turn into a wet, slippery mess.
For a washer, turn off the water first, then disconnect the supply hoses and allow them to drain completely into a bucket or tray. If the hoses are left wet, they can leave water across floors, stairs, or the truck bed.
The cleanest pickup routes are the ones that have already been opened up. A hallway with shoes, plants, or boxes in the way slows everyone down and increases the chance of wall or trim damage.
If you are working with a rental, apartment, or managed property, check whether the appliance removal must be scheduled through building management. That is especially useful for elevator access, loading dock use, or service hours.
Small Oversights That Can Turn Into Bigger Problems
A refrigerator that still has condensation inside can be slippery during the move. A washer with water trapped in the hoses can drip on floors or make a mess in the truck. These details are easy to miss, but they are the ones that create avoidable problems.
Refrigerator disposal is not the same as hauling a broken chair. Older units often need a route that accounts for recycling requirements, and that should be part of the service, not an afterthought.
For stacked laundry sets, the work is usually less about brute strength and more about control. One mistake in a narrow laundry room can scrape cabinets or chip a tile floor.
If you are comparing appliance pickup Austin TX same week options, ask whether the crew will disconnect the appliance or whether that is expected to be done ahead of time. Some providers include it, while others expect the unit to be ready to move.
